Abstract
A weld nut for use in securing a fastener to a sheet of supporting material. The weld nut comprises a triangular-shaped plate with truncated vertices. The plate has a mating surface from which are raised first, second and third integral projections. Each of the integral projections has a frusto-conical body with a rounded top and is surrounded by an annular channel to contain the flow of the material forming the projection when the nut is welded to the supporting material. Each channel preferably intersects an adjacent truncated end to permit the formation of an external fillet.
